Output 3dd28d12acd33b60cf26112cb5f8a1898f58dedcad83ce9e54f5fb4e543bd314:0

value
22738700
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 627ad15ae4303b95743f6b8dcffbf9f7fa0ba7d8 OP_EQUALVERIFY OP_CHECKSIG
address
19yiML6butvedGvJ1123r8rZw6FYptbDUc
transaction
3dd28d12acd33b60cf26112cb5f8a1898f58dedcad83ce9e54f5fb4e543bd314
confirmations
548001
spent
true